Dr. Roman is the Providers and Clinical Steerage Director for Latin America & Europe at VUMI. He is an internationally recognized physician, health management expert, and bridge-builder between the worlds of clinical practice, healthcare systems innovation, and cross-cultural collaboration. With deep roots in both Latin America and Europe, Dr. Roman brings a unique global perspective to health leadership — one grounded in frontline experience, strategic insight, and a passion for equitable, technology-enabled care. 

A medical doctor by training, Dr. Roman’s professional journey spans clinical practice, health systems leadership, medical education, and strategic healthcare consulting.

Over the course of his career, he has worked to strengthen care delivery models, improve physician-to-patient relationships, and advance health outcomes across diverse settings. Known for his leadership in health management and interdisciplinary problem-solving, Dr. Roman consistently emphasizes the importance of connecting people, ideas, and innovations to transform healthcare delivery. 

Dr. Roman’s work is deeply informed by his bicultural identity and professional experience across Peru and Spain — two regions where he has engaged with healthcare systems at both policy and practice levels. He often speaks about the value of constructing bridges between different medical traditions, technological innovations, and cultural contexts to foster a more inclusive, effective approach to care. In a recent reflection on Hispanic cultural ties and health innovation, he described himself as a “nexus between two lands,” committed to integrating traditional knowledge with cutting-edge medical science to benefit communities on both continents. 

In addition to his healthcare leadership, Dr. Roman is an active contributor to professional development and continuing education. He has participated in programs focused on healthcare pedagogy and leadership, including completing the XIX Program of Development of Teaching Skills at Universidad ESAN, underscoring his commitment to lifelong learning and teaching.
